Digital Air Flow Meters for Construction Projects

Wiki Article

Employing an digital air flow meter in construction projects offers numerous benefits. These meters accurately measure airflow velocity and volume, providing vital data to HVAC system design and performance monitoring. Developers can utilize this information for the purpose of optimize ventilation, ensure proper air circulation, and enhance indoor air quality. The digital readout facilitates easy monitoring and evaluation, resulting in more efficient construction practices.

Accurate Digital Flow Meter Selection

In the realm of civil engineering projects, precise quantification of fluid flow is paramount. Whether it's irrigation distribution, chemical pipeline operation, or developmental site runoff analysis, accurate and reliable flow data is essential for optimal project success. Digital Flow Meters have emerged as the gold standard for achieving this level of precision. These sophisticated instruments utilize sensor-based technology to measure flow rate with remarkable accuracy, providing invaluable insights into fluid dynamics and enabling informed decision-making throughout the project lifecycle.
